Morecambe and Heysham Grosvenor Park Primary School continues to demonstrate effective and commendable educational practices, reaffirming its status as a good school. Pupils exhibit enthusiasm for learning and feel secure in their environment, which is bolstered by strong relationships between staff, students, and parents. Extracurricular activities are diverse and well-received, contributing to a positive school culture where students take on leadership roles and engage with their community. The school has prioritized early reading, with effective strategies for supporting students’ literacy skills.

Strengths

  • Positive relationships between staff, pupils, and families.
  • High expectations for all pupils, including those with SEND.
  • Effective reading instruction and support for struggling readers.
  • Ambitious curriculum meeting pupils' needs and interests.
  • Strong behaviour management leading to a conducive learning environment.
  • Diverse extracurricular experiences available to pupils.
  • Diligent communication with parents about pupil progress.

Areas for Improvement

  • Some subjects lack finalised knowledge sequencing and delivery timelines.
  • Insufficient understanding of diverse faiths and cultures among some pupils.

Progress Scores

A progress score is a way to measure how well a student progressed in comparison to other students of a similar starting ability. A score of zero means would mean that a student made the same progress as others that had a similar starting a ability. A positive score would mean that the student made more progress than other students of similar starting ability. The scores below are for the whole school so is the average progress score across all students.
